Music playback using Bluetooth wireless
technology

The unit is capable of playing back music stored on Bluetooth

capable devices (cell phones, digital music players etc.)

wirelessly. You can also use a Bluetooth audio transmitter

(sold separately) to enjoy music from devices that do not have

Bluetooth functionality. Please refer to the user’s manual for

your Bluetooth capable device for more details.

• The Bluetooth wireless technology enabled device must

support A2DP profiles.

• Pioneer does not guarantee proper connection and

operation of this unit with all Bluetooth wireless

technology enabled devices.

Remote control operation

The remote control supplied with this unit allows you to play

and stop media, and perform other operations.

Note

• The Bluetooth wireless technology enabled device must

support AVRCP profiles.

• Remote control operations cannot be guaranteed for all

Bluetooth wireless technology enabled devices.

Pairing with the unit (Initial registration)

In order for the unit to playback music stored on a Bluetooth

capable device, pairing must first be performed. Pairing

should be performed when first using the unit with the

Bluetooth capable device, or when the pairing data on the

device has been erased for any reason.

Pairing is a step required to allow communication using

Bluetooth wireless technology to be carried out.

• Pairing is only performed the first time that you use the

unit and the Bluetooth capable device together.

• In order to allow communication using Bluetooth

wireless technology to take place, pairing must be

performed on both the unit and the Bluetooth capable

device.

• After pressing the BT AUDIO and switching to BT

AUDIO

input, perform the pairing procedure on the

Bluetooth capable device. If pairing has been performed

correctly, you will not need to perform the pairing

procedures for the unit as shown below.

Please refer to the user’s manual for your Bluetooth capable

device for more details.

1

Press the

STANDBY/ON and turn the

power to the unit on.

2

Press the BT AUDIO.

The unit switches to BT AUDIO and “PAIRING” will be

displayed.

3

Turn on the power to the

Bluetooth capable

device that you wish to pair with, and perform
pairing procedure on it.
